what is the slope of the line 5x +2y = -15

Respuesta :

schaudhry915 schaudhry915
  • 12-11-2020

Answer:

-5/2

Step-by-step explanation:

5x +2y = -15

-5x          -5x

2y = -5x - 15

y = -5/2x - 7.5

y = mx + b

Slope (m) = -5/2

down 5, right 2
